ORIC Pharmaceuticals is a clinical stage biopharmaceutical company dedicated to improving patients’ lives by Overcoming Resistance In Cancer. ORIC’s lead product candidate, ORIC-101, is a potent and selective small molecule antagonist of the glucocorticoid receptor, which has been linked to resistance to multiple classes of cancer therapeutics across a variety of solid tumors.Job Description

We are looking for a motivated and experienced researcher to join our In Vivo Pharmacology group. The individual will execute in vivo efficacy and PK/PD studies in support of ORIC’s drug development programs. Reports to the In Vivo Pharmacology group leader and collaborates extensively with DMPK and Biology teams.
Tasks and Responsibilities:
Other duties may be assigned.
- Demonstrates technical in vitro skills (proficiency performing in vitro cell culture, scale-up, banking and maintenance of frozen stocks)
- Demonstrates technical in vivo skills (proficiency in handling rodents, administering therapeutics via various routes, tumor implantation and measurement, blood collection, animal necropsy)
- Executes in vivo studies using skills focused on identifying candidate molecules and translational research within the area of oncology with guidance
- Prepares formulation and dosing solutions
- Collects, records and analyzes data in electronic notebook format using programs such as Microsoft Office Applications, Prism and Benchling
- Perform all duties in keeping with the Company's core values, policies and all applicable regulations.
Requirements:
- A B.Sc. in Biology, Pharmacology or related discipline with 1+ years life sciences experience with a strong focus on in vivo pharmacology in an industry setting
- Experience in utilizing preclinical cancer models (xenograft, syngeneic and PDX) and applied technologies enabling in vivo analyses
- Hands-on experience in relevant ex vivo experimental and molecular biology techniques such as cell culture, ELISA, qPCR, western blot, immunohistochemistry, flow cytometry and cell immunophenotyping is a plus
- Familiarity with the regulatory requirements to remain compliant with IACUC and AALAC regulations
- Ability to maintain proper scientific documentation associated with pharmacology studies in electronic lab notebooks, write technical reports and present summaries of research results
